Join Richard Peña as he answers the question: What could the Latin side of jazz guitar sound like? Each track is an answer, showcasing how the guitar can stand as an equal to instruments like the piano, cuatro, or tres in leading a band melodically, harmonically, and rhythmically.

Titled “Youth Jazz Ambassador” by the Humacao Friends of Jazz Association, Richard Peña has performed internationally as a bandleader and with Grammy-winning artists ranging from Horacio “El Negro” Hernandez to Victor Manuelle. The 26-year-old guitarist and composer has managed to establish his musical mark in the Latin American jazz community, publishing 4 award-winning record productions acclaimed by magazines such as Jazz Corner and All About Jazz.
